Itinerary description
This is not an official snowshoe trail, but we found it well maintained all through.
From Salvan station, go up the metal stairs and up the road, towards Les Granges. After, follow for Van d'en Bas. After Les Granges, leave the road in a curve to the left, where you go straight up into the forest. Follow the forest path until you hit another road, turn right and continue climbing up. When reaching the Auberge, cross the road and go up into the hamlet (abandoned in winter). We followed a path through the hamlet and out again until we hit the road again. Turn right and follow the road a few minutes until you see a bridge on the left. Cross the bridge and follow the path left. Follow the path until you hit the same road again where you walked up before.
Instead of walking back the same way along the road, we kept right and walked up a bit more. Cross the next road and stay in the forest on a small path. Further down, turn left towards Salvan and follow for the sign for the train station.
Walked in January 2021 in easy 4 hours with two little breaks.
Moderate only because not an official trail.
